What is creative development in film?

Creative development in film refers to the early stage of filmmaking where ideas are generated and shaped into a coherent story. This process includes brainstorming concepts, writing or refining scripts, and developing characters, themes, and visual styles. Creative development often involves collaboration between writers, producers, directors, and other creatives to ensure the story is compelling and feasible for production. It's a crucial phase that lays the groundwork for the entire film project.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in creative development for film?

To thrive in Creative Development for Film, you need a strong background in storytelling, script analysis, and an understanding of film production, often supported by a degree in film, media, or a related field. Familiarity with screenwriting software (such as Final Draft), storyboarding tools, and industry-standard project management systems is common. Exceptional communication, creative vision, and collaboration skills help professionals stand out when pitching ideas and working with writers, directors, and producers. These abilities are crucial for shaping compelling stories and ensuring successful project development in a competitive industry.

What are some typical challenges faced by professionals in creative development for film, and how can they be addressed?

Creative development professionals in film often face challenges such as balancing artistic vision with commercial viability, managing feedback from multiple stakeholders, and navigating tight deadlines. Successfully addressing these issues requires strong communication skills, adaptability, and a collaborative mindset. Building solid relationships with writers, directors, and producers is key, as is being open to revisions while maintaining the project's core vision. Staying organized and proactive in anticipating potential obstacles can also help ensure a smoother development process.

What is the difference between Creative Development Film vs Creative Producer?

AspectCreative Development FilmCreative Producer
Primary RoleConceptualizing and developing film ideas, scripts, and storylinesOverseeing the production process, managing budgets, and coordinating teams
Required SkillsCreative writing, storytelling, script developmentProject management, budgeting, team coordination
Work EnvironmentCreative offices, studios, script workshopsOn-set, production offices, post-production facilities
Industry UsageUsed in early-stage film development and script creationUsed throughout production to ensure project delivery

While Creative Development Film focuses on creating and refining film concepts and scripts, Creative Producers handle the overall production process, managing resources and timelines. Both roles are essential in filmmaking but differ in their core responsibilities and stages of film creation.

Amazon.com, Inc., commonly known as Amazon, is an American multinational technology company. It was founded by Jeff Bezos in 1994 and initially started as an online marketplace for books. Since then, Amazon has expanded its operations and become one of the largest e-commerce companies in the world. Amazon's primary business is its online retail platform, where customers can purchase a vast array of products, including electronics, clothing, books, home goods, and much more. The company offers a convenient and user-friendly shopping experience, with features such as fast shipping, customer reviews, and personalized recommendations. In addition to its e-commerce platform, Amazon has diversified its business into various other areas. One of its notable ventures is Amazon Web Services (AWS), a comprehensive cloud computing platform that provides services such as storage, compute power, and database management to individuals and businesses. AWS has become a leader in the cloud computing industry, powering many websites and applications worldwide. Amazon has also developed its own consumer electronics, including the popular Amazon Kindle e-reader, Fire tablets, Fire TV streaming devices, and the Alexa-powered Echo smart speakers. The Alexa voice assistant, integrated into these devices, allows users to interact with their devices using voice commands, perform tasks, and access information. Furthermore, Amazon has expanded into media and entertainment. It operates Prime Video, a streaming service that offers a wide range of movies, TV shows, and original content. Amazon Music provides a platform for streaming and purchasing digital music, while Audible offers audiobooks and other audio content. The company's commitment to customer satisfaction and convenience is demonstrated by its membership program, Amazon Prime. Prime members receive various benefits, including free two-day shipping, access to streaming services, exclusive deals, and more.
